How much does it cost to rent a home in Forest City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Forest City 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,701 | $1,425 | $2,650 |
| Forest City 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,150 | $1,650 | $3,000 |
| Forest City 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,615 | $1,750 | $3,600 |
| Forest City 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,181 | $900 | $3,175 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Forest City
What type of rentals are currently available in Forest City?
There are currently 70 Apartments for Rent in Forest City,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,159 to $5,516. There are also 158 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Forest City ranging from $800 to $3,600.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Forest City?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Forest City ranges from $800 to $3,600 with an average monthly rent of $1,985.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Forest City?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Forest City range from $1,516 to $5,516,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,650 to $3,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,750 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,700.
